How do you make homemade pet neutralizer?

To make a homemade pet odor neutralizer, mix equal parts white vinegar and water in a spray bottle to break down ammonia, then add 2 tablespoons of baking soda for deodorizing. For stubborn stains, combine 2 cups hydrogen peroxide, 2 teaspoons baking soda, and 1/2 teaspoon dish soap.

How do you make homemade smell neutralizer?

All-Purpose Odor Eliminator Spray

Grab an empty 16oz spray bottle and add one cup of distilled water, ½ cup white vinegar, two tablespoons of rubbing alcohol, and 10 drops of lemon essential oil. Put the top on the spray bottle and give it a good shake before each use.

What is the best homemade cleaner for pet urine?

For pet urine out of anything (porch, carpet, hardwood flooring) use 1 part liquid detergent, 1 part white vinegar and 2 parts water in a spray bottle. Spray area then let set for about 15 minutes, rinse. Smell is gone and pets won't go back to that spot.

How to make your own enzyme cleaner for dog urine?

Use orange or lemon peels to eliminate urine stains naturally. The smell will also become very fresh and citrusy. Fill one jar with one orange peel or lemon peel and pour one cup of distilled white vinegar into the jar. Seal the jar and let it sit for about a week to infuse with the citrus oils.

Why does my house still smell like dog pee after cleaning?

Urine is in the carpet pad, not just the carpet

They don't address problems with the underlying pad. Even certain “professional” carpet cleaning companies do nothing to treat the pad. Store bought pet urine shampoos and sprays don't remove that urine from the carpet. However, they can mask it's odor with deodorizers.
